Android: Fix linker erros for liblog & libc

For the android platform library add dependencies on liblog and libc
for every Qt target.

The libraries are shipped by default in the Android NDK so they will
always be present.

# When building on android we need to link against their logging and C library
# in order to satisfy linker dependencies. Both of these libraries are part of
# the NDK.
if (ANDROID)
target_link_libraries(Platform INTERFACE log c)
endif()
